A fantastic English drama all played out as the days of the rich and privileged are dwindling evermore and England is fast approaching the start of WW II. Though a personal drama of wrongful accusations, it's impossible to wonder what the lives of those involved COULD have been if life had been just a bit fairer. It was first encounter with James McAvoy, and he has since turned out to be one of my favourite leading male actors. Keira K. is very good, but Saorise Ronan as the younger girl is dynamic as she acts to an Academy Award Nomination in a supporting role for 2007.
